MUFG is seeking a Director to lead the U.S. Broker-Dealer Regulatory Affairs & Registrations function. This role provides enterprise leadership, governance, and strategic oversight of the firm's regulatory affairs, regulatory reporting, licensing, and registration programs. The goal is to ensure the organization maintains a strong regulatory posture and a sustainable control environment. The role is accountable for establishing and maintaining a consistent framework for regulatory engagement, supervisory interactions, regulatory reporting, and registration governance that supports business growth while meeting the expectations of FINRA, the SEC, the NFA, and other applicable regulators. Operating within the Compliance function and the Three Lines of Defense framework, the role serves as a trusted advisor to senior leadership and is responsible for driving regulatory readiness, enhancing governance practices, and promoting a culture of accountability, transparency, and continuous improvement across the U.S. broker-dealer environment.
